The cause of reddish-brown stains on your dogâs white fur is not completely understood, but theyâre thought to be caused by an iron-containing pigment in your dogâs tears, saliva, and urine called porphyrins. If you will be using a vinegar solution, get 1/4 cup of white vinegar, a teaspoon each of baking soda and dish detergent, a 240mL of cold water (the proteins in dog drool can be cooked by hot water and make it set; so, cold water is better), a spray bottle for the mixture, and a clean rag.
